  • About Locum Gastroenterologist Jobs :

    This is a generalized description of locum gastroenterologist job requirements. Specific assignment details may vary based on the facility, patient population and the type of gastroenterology practiced.

    General Job Responsibilities :

  • Diagnose and treat a wide range of digestive system disorders in adults and potentially children (depending on the position).
  • Conduct comprehensive patient histories and physical examinations.
  • Order and interpret diagnostic tests such as endoscopies, X-rays, CT scans and blood tests.
  • Perform endoscopic procedures to diagnose and treat digestive conditions (depending on the scope of practice).
  • Develop and implement treatment plans.
  • Manage chronic digestive conditions and provide ongoing patient care.
  • Collaborate with surgeons, radiologists and other specialists when needed to ensure coordinated care.
  • Educate patients on digestive health and disease prevention.
  • Maintain accurate and complete medical records for all patients.
  • Stay current on the latest advancements in gastroenterology through continuing education.

  • Minimum Education Requirements :

  • Doctor of Medicine (MD) degree or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(DO) degree from an accredited medical school.
  • Residency training program in internal medicine accredited by the Accreditation Council for Graduate Medical Education (ACGME) or American Osteopathic Association (AOA).
  • Fellowship training in gastroenterology (may be preferred depending on the position).
  • License & Certifications :

  • Board certification in gastroenterology by the American Board of Internal Medicine (ABIM) or the AOA.
  • Active and unrestricted medical license in Georgia.
  • Experience :

  • While specific requirements may vary, most locum gastroenterologist positions prefer candidates with at least one year of experience providing gastroenterology care in a clinical or hospital setting.
